A new twist in the vaccination hysteria tale

Apparently, the Daily Mail in Ireland and the Daily Mail in the UK are currently running seperate campaigns about the HPV Vaccine. Nothing unusual about that, you might think. It’s an important subject and the Daily Mail has a duty to be concerned.   But, y’see, ha, ha, here’s the thing.

The two editions of the paper are running campaigns both for and against the vaccine. That’s right, in Ireland, the newspaper is very firmly for it, but in the UK, on the other hand…. you get stories such as this.

The Daily Fail at its finest. So much failure its hard to know where to start. From the British side there’s the standard anti-vaccination pseudo-science we’ve seen before. On the Irish side there’s a standard nonsensical “why doesn’t the government do something” whining from a right-wing paper that typically promotes lower taxes and thus a SMALLER government. Then we have to decide whether they are so stupid that they didn’t think anyone would notice, or that they are so disorganised that they couldn’t co-ordinate their campaigns across the two publications.

We are watching the old media beast writhing around in it’s death throes here – the only slightly worrying thing is that there’s a lack of trustworthy sources springing up to replace it.
